ACCESS 追加クエリの作成方法

Microsoft Accessは強力なデータベース管理ツールであり、その追加クエリ機能を使用すると、既存のテーブルに新しいデータを簡単に追加できます。追加クエリは、他のテーブルや外部ソースからのデータを統合する際に特に便利です。本記事では、Accessでの追加クエリの作成方法をステップバイステップで解説します。初心者でも簡単に理解できるように、具体的な手順と例を示しながら、追加クエリの作成と実行方法を紹介します。効果的なデータ管理を実現するために、追加クエリの使い方をマスターしましょう。
ACCESS 追加クエリの基本的な作成方法
ACCESS 追加クエリは、既存のテーブルに新しいデータを追加するためのクエリです。このクエリを使用することで、データベースのデータを効率的に更新できます。追加クエリを作成するには、まず、追加するデータのソースと、データを追加するターゲットテーブルを決定する必要があります。
追加クエリの設計
追加クエリを作成する最初のステップは、クエリの設計です。ACCESSのクエリデザイナを使用して、追加クエリを設計できます。デザイナでは、データソースの選択、フィールドの追加、条件の設定などを行うことができます。クエリの種類 を「追加クエリ」に設定し、ターゲットテーブル を選択します。
- クエリデザイナを開き、新しいクエリを作成します。
- データソースとして、追加するデータを含むテーブルまたはクエリを選択します。
- フィールドを追加し、必要なフィールドのマッピング を行います。
追加クエリの条件設定
追加クエリでは、追加するデータをフィルタリングするための条件を設定できます。条件式 を使用して、特定の条件を満たすデータのみを追加することができます。条件式は、フィールド、演算子、および値で構成されます。
- クエリデザイナの「条件」行に、条件式を入力します。
- AND または OR を使用して、複数の条件を組み合わせることができます。
- 条件式の例: `[フィールド名] = 値`
追加クエリの実行
クエリの設計と条件の設定が完了したら、追加クエリを実行できます。クエリを実行すると、指定された条件に基づいてデータがターゲットテーブルに追加されます。
- クエリデザイナでクエリを実行するには、「実行」ボタンをクリックします。
- クエリを実行する前に、データの追加 を確認するメッセージが表示されます。
- クエリの実行後に、ターゲットテーブルのデータをチェックして、データが正しく追加されたことを確認します。
追加クエリのテストと検証
追加クエリを作成した後は、クエリが正しく動作することを確認するためにテストと検証を行うことが重要です。テストデータ を使用してクエリを実行し、結果を確認します。
- テストデータを用意し、クエリを実行します。
- クエリの実行結果を確認し、期待どおりの結果 であることを検証します。
- 必要に応じて、クエリを修正し、再度テストを実行します。
追加クエリのメンテナンス
追加クエリは、データベースのメンテナンスにおいて重要な役割を果たします。クエリのパフォーマンス と 正確性 を維持するために、定期的なメンテナンスが必要です。
- クエリのパフォーマンスを監視し、必要に応じて最適化 を行います。
- データベースの構造変更に伴い、クエリを更新 します。
- クエリの実行ログをチェックし、問題の早期発見 に努めます。
クエリの作成手順は?

クエリの作成手順は、データベースから必要なデータを取得するために重要なプロセスです。まず、データベースの構造と必要なデータを理解する必要があります。次に、適切なクエリ言語(SQLなど)を選択し、クエリを記述します。クエリの記述には、データのフィルタリング、ソート、集計などの操作が含まれます。
クエリの基本構造
クエリの基本構造は、データベースからデータを取得するための基本的な枠組みを提供します。クエリの基本構造には、SELECT文、FROM句、WHERE句などが含まれます。これらの要素を組み合わせることで、必要なデータを取得するためのクエリを作成できます。
- SELECT文を使用して、取得するデータを指定します。
- FROM句を使用して、データを取得するテーブルを指定します。
- WHERE句を使用して、データのフィルタリング条件を指定します。
クエリの最適化
クエリの最適化は、クエリのパフォーマンスを向上させるために重要です。クエリの最適化には、インデックスの作成、サブクエリの最適化、結合の最適化などが含まれます。これらのテクニックを使用することで、クエリの実行時間を短縮し、データベースのパフォーマンスを向上させることができます。
- インデックスの作成を使用して、データの検索を高速化します。
- サブクエリの最適化を使用して、サブクエリの実行を最適化します。
- 結合の最適化を使用して、テーブルの結合を最適化します。
クエリのテストとデバッグ
クエリのテストとデバッグは、クエリが正しく動作することを確認するために重要です。クエリのテストとデバッグには、クエリの実行、結果の検証、エラーの修正などが含まれます。これらのプロセスを繰り返すことで、クエリの品質を向上させることができます。
- クエリの実行を使用して、クエリを実行し、結果を取得します。
- 結果の検証を使用して、クエリの結果が正しいことを確認します。
- エラーの修正を使用して、クエリのエラーを修正します。
アクセスのクエリで行を追加するにはどうすればいいですか?

アクセスのクエリに行を追加するには、まずクエリの基本的な構造を理解する必要があります。アクセスのクエリは、データベースから特定のデータを抽出するために使用されます。行を追加するには、INSERT INTOステートメントを使用します。このステートメントでは、データを追加するテーブルと、追加するデータを指定します。
クエリの基本構造
クエリの基本構造を理解することで、行を追加するクエリを書くことができます。クエリは、SELECT、INSERT、UPDATE、DELETEなどのステートメントで構成されます。行を追加するには、INSERT INTOステートメントを使用します。
- INSERT INTOステートメントの基本的な構文は、INSERT INTO テーブル名 (列1, 列2, …) VALUES (値1, 値2, …)です。
- テーブル名と列名は、実際のテーブルと列の名前に置き換えます。
- 値は、追加するデータを指定します。
行を追加する際の注意点
行を追加する際には、いくつかの注意点があります。まず、データ型を確認する必要があります。追加するデータの型が、列のデータ型と一致していることを確認します。また、主キーやユニーク制約などの制約を確認する必要があります。
- データ型が一致していない場合、エラーが発生する可能性があります。
- 主キーやユニーク制約に違反した場合、エラーが発生する可能性があります。
- トランザクションを使用して、複数の操作を一つの単位として管理することができます。
アクセスでのクエリの実行
アクセスでクエリを実行するには、クエリを設計ビューで作成し、実行します。クエリデザイナーを使用して、クエリを視覚的に作成することができます。
- クエリデザイナーを使用して、INSERT INTOステートメントを作成します。
- クエリを実行する前に、クエリの構文を確認します。
- クエリを実行して、行が追加されたことを確認します。
Accessの追加クエリと更新クエリの違いは何ですか?

Accessの追加クエリと更新クエリの違いは、データベースの操作において重要な概念です。追加クエリは、既存のテーブルに新しいレコードを追加するために使用されます。一方、更新クエリは、既存のテーブルのレコードを更新するために使用されます。
追加クエリの特徴
追加クエリは、新しいデータをデータベースに追加する際に使用されます。このクエリを使用すると、既存のテーブルの構造を変更することなく、新しいレコードを追加できます。追加クエリの主な特徴は次のとおりです。
- 新しいレコードの追加が可能
- 既存のテーブルの構造を変更しない
- データの整合性を維持するために、適切なフィールドを指定する必要がある
更新クエリの特徴
更新クエリは、既存のデータベースのレコードを更新する際に使用されます。このクエリを使用すると、特定の条件に基づいてレコードのフィールドを更新できます。更新クエリの主な特徴は次のとおりです。
- 既存のレコードの更新が可能
- 条件を指定して、更新するレコードを絞り込むことができる
- データの一貫性を維持するために、適切な更新規則を指定する必要がある
追加クエリと更新クエリの使い分け
追加クエリと更新クエリを適切に使い分けることで、データベースの管理が効率化されます。データの追加が必要な場合は追加クエリを、データの更新が必要な場合は更新クエリを使用します。両者の使い分けは、データベースのデータ整合性と一貫性を維持する上で重要です。
- データの追加が必要な場合に追加クエリを使用する
- データの更新が必要な場合に更新クエリを使用する
- データベースの整合性を維持するために、クエリの設計を慎重に行う必要がある
クエリにテーブルを追加するにはどうすればいいですか?

クエリにテーブルを追加するには、データベース設計とSQLの基本的な理解が必要です。クエリにテーブルを追加する主な方法は、JOIN句を使用することです。これにより、複数のテーブルからデータを結合して取得できます。
クエリにテーブルを追加する基本
クエリにテーブルを追加する基本は、関係データベースの構造を理解することです。関係データベースでは、データは複数のテーブルに分割され、主キーと外部キーによって関連付けられます。クエリにテーブルを追加するには、これらのキーを使用してテーブルを結合する必要があります。
- 主キーを特定する: テーブルの主キーは、一意のレコードを識別するカラムです。
- 外部キーを設定する: 外部キーは、別のテーブルの主キーを参照するカラムです。
- JOIN句を使用してテーブルを結合する: JOIN句には、INNER JOIN、LEFT JOIN、RIGHT JOINなどがあります。
JOIN句の種類
JOIN句にはいくつかの種類があり、データの結合方法を指定できます。INNER JOINは、両方のテーブルに存在するレコードのみを返します。LEFT JOINは、左側のテーブルのすべてのレコードと、右側のテーブルの一致するレコードを返します。
- INNER JOINを使用する: 両方のテーブルに存在するレコードのみを取得します。
- LEFT JOINを使用する: 左側のテーブルのすべてのレコードを取得します。
- RIGHT JOINを使用する: 右側のテーブルのすべてのレコードを取得します。
クエリの最適化
クエリにテーブルを追加する際には、パフォーマンスの最適化も重要です。インデックスを作成することで、クエリの実行速度を向上させることができます。また、サブクエリの使用を避け、結合を適切に使用することで、クエリを最適化できます。
- インデックスを作成する: 頻繁に使用されるカラムにインデックスを作成します。
- サブクエリの使用を避ける: サブクエリはクエリの実行速度を低下させる可能性があります。
- 結合を適切に使用する: 結合を適切に使用することで、クエリの実行速度を向上させることができます。
詳細情報
ACCESS 追加クエリとは何ですか?
ACCESS 追加クエリは、既存のテーブルに新しいデータを追加するためのクエリです。このクエリを使用することで、複数のテーブルからデータを抽出し、一つのテーブルにまとめることができます。追加クエリを作成するには、まずクエリデザイナを開き、追加元のテーブルと追加先のテーブルを選択する必要があります。
ACCESS 追加クエリの作成手順
ACCESS 追加クエリを作成するには、まずクエリデザイナを開きます。次に、追加元のテーブルを選択し、追加するフィールドを指定します。その後、追加先のテーブルを選択し、実行ボタンをクリックすることでクエリが実行されます。クエリの実行後、結果を確認し、必要に応じてクエリを修正します。
ACCESS 追加クエリの注意点
ACCESS 追加クエリを実行する際には、データの整合性に注意する必要があります。追加元のデータにエラーや矛盾がある場合、追加先のテーブルに不正確なデータが追加される可能性があります。そのため、クエリを実行する前に、データの検証を行うことが重要です。
ACCESS 追加クエリの応用例
ACCESS 追加クエリは、データの統合やデータのバックアップなど、さまざまな用途で使用できます。たとえば、複数の支店のデータを一つの本部のテーブルにまとめる場合や、過去のデータを新しいテーブルにバックアップする場合などに使用できます。追加クエリを効果的に使用することで、データ管理の効率化を図ることができます。





